Julia Roberts Gave Birth to Twins at 37 — Pics of Her ‘Beautiful’ Teens Who Look like Her Husband

Julia Roberts, at 37, joyfully welcomed twins, Phinnaeus and Hazel, and later had Henry. Motherhood in her late 30s felt right, as she believes her kids came into her life when she was ready to be their mother. Living away from the Hollywood scene in New Mexico and San Francisco, Julia and husband Danny Moder shielded their kids from fame’s harms.

The actress prioritizes protecting her kids, even banning them from social media to ease the pressures of the modern world. Julia emphasizes unconditional love and guides them through challenges. When Hazel struggled, Julia took her to the Women’s March to empower her. Hazel, described as “one of a kind,” attended the Cannes Film Festival in 2021, showcasing her individuality.

Despite their efforts, Julia acknowledges the ongoing learning curve in motherhood. The actress, feeling both lightheaded and excited, shared her emotions as her twins prepared for college. While Julia thinks her kids resemble her, she recognizes her husband’s influence on their looks. Fans adore their family, praising the couple’s commitment to a 21-year marriage and the beautiful children they’ve raised.
